The NVIDIA SHIELD Android TV Pro features an NVIDA Tegra X1 CPU (the same processor found in the Nintendo Switch), 3GB of RAM, and 16GB of onboard storage. In terms of performance and versatility, the Shield Pro beats Roku, Apple TV, Fire Stick, and Chromecast, and pretty much any other media player, hands down. It’s also extremely format-friendly; it supports every audio codec, including Hi-Res Lossless, and almost all video codecs (except AV1). It’s also compatible with Dolby Atmos and Dolby Digital Plus, as well as 4K Dolby Vision HDR and HDR10 (not HDR10+).

The Shield Pro is one of the few devices that supports GeForce Now, so you can stream your PC games to your TV without having to own a gaming PC. A remote PC does all the processing work for you, and all you need is a fast internet connection. The Shield Pro is also the best streaming device for anyone who still has a large library of local media content. It has a built-in Plex server, so you can organize all your digital media in one central location.

If you are looking for only Stream 4K movies and TV shows from popular apps, there are plenty of other solid – and less expensive – options these days. But if you’re looking for a device that can do a lot more, like act as a central server for your localized media, or stream lots of lossless Hi-Fi or Atmos audio content, or play PC games without a huge investment, or if you’re simply not part of the Apple ecosystem yet, then the Shield TV Pro is still the most powerful and versatile choice on the market.
